Abstract
The starting matl contains (all wt. %) 6-15 In, 0.2-8 Sn, balance Ag; the alloy ay also contain 0.01-1 Mg and/or Cu. Alternatively, the alloy may consists of 6-15 In, 0.01-1 Mg, balance Ag, or 6-15 In, 0.01-1 Mg and 0.01-1 Ni. Although the existing silver oxide-cadmium oxide matls. have excellent props as electrical contacts, cadmium constitutes a danger to the health of workers and thus an alternative matl is required. The Ag-In-Sn oxides and Ag-In-Mg oxides possess excellent resistance to burning-off, welding and arc-erosion and are at least as good as Ag-Cd oxide contacts.
